GENERAL SUMMARY OF DUTIES
Responsible for correctly coding healthcare claims in order to obtain reimbursement from insurance companies and government healthcare programs.
P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ES
Reads and analyzes patient records Determines correct codes for patient records Uses codes to bill insurance providers Interacts with physicians and nurse practitioners to ensure accuracy Manages detailed, specifically-coded information Assists with charge entry Maintains patient confidentiality and information security
EDUCATION/CERTIFICATION
High School Diploma or GED required Current Certified Professional Coder preferred but not required•AHIMA or
AAPC KNOWLEDGE/SKILLS/ABILITIES
Understands CPT and ICD-10 guidelines Familiarity with federal and governmental payer guidelines Familiarity with workers compensation payer guidelines Versed in insurance and use of modifiers Pays close attention to detail and is very accurate Maintains excellent concentration and focus Possesses strong analytical skills to identify discrepancies Must work well in a team setting
WORK SCHEDULE
Monday•Friday, 8 am•5 pm
